Global Hotel Industry Poised for Significant Revenue Growth Through System Connectivity, SiteMinder Research Reveals
New research from SiteMinder indicates that the global hotel industry, particularly in key markets like the US, France, Spain, Mexico, Indonesia, and Australia, stands to gain billions of dollars through enhanced seamless system connectivity. This connectivity is identified as a critical driver for revenue growth and improved operational efficiency.
The study highlights that hotels are increasingly recognizing the substantial financial benefits of integrating their various operational systems. This integration allows for a more unified and streamlined approach to managing bookings, guest data, and distribution channels.
SiteMinder’s findings suggest that a primary focus for the industry is the optimization of revenue through direct bookings and the effective management of online travel agencies (OTAs). By ensuring systems communicate efficiently, hotels can reduce manual work, minimize errors, and ultimately capture more revenue.
The research underscores a global trend where technology adoption, specifically in system connectivity, is becoming paramount for hotels aiming to compete effectively in a dynamic market. This includes leveraging platforms that can connect a hotel’s property management system (PMS) with booking engines, channel managers, and other critical software.
In the US, France, Spain, Mexico, Indonesia, and Australia, hotels are exploring ways to harness this connectivity to attract a wider customer base and enhance the guest experience. The ability to present real-time availability and accurate pricing across multiple channels is seen as a key factor in driving bookings and maximizing occupancy.
The research points to the potential for significant financial returns as hotels invest in and adopt these interconnected solutions. The expectation is that this will translate into substantial revenue increases for the participating markets.
